Cameron Diaz and her The Green Hornet crew popped up in Berlin today for their latest photo call. She was decked out in tight jeans, boots, and a blazer to pose alongside costars Seth Rogen, Jay Chou, and Christoph Waltz. The gang is in the midst of a European promotional tour, which started Wednesday with an event in Madrid. Fortunately, Cameron's well-rested for the traveling after recharging her batteries with a bikini-filled Miami vacation and a hot getaway with Alex Rodriguez to Mexico. She, Seth, Jay, and Christoph have a long road ahead, since their blockbuster doesn't arrive on screens in the US until Jan. 14.